Age Limit
The exact age limit for applicants will be mentioned in the official notification. Generally, for RRB recruitments, the lower age limit is 18 years, and the upper age limit varies by post, often up to 28 or 30 years for the Technician cadre. The government provides standard age relaxations for reserved categories: 5 years for SC/ST candidates, 3 years for OBC (Non-Creamy Layer) candidates, and 10 years for PwD candidates. Additional relaxations for ex-servicemen and other categories as per government rules will also be applicable. The final age criteria and relaxations will be clearly stated in the official notification.

Selection Process
Based on previous RRB recruitments for technical posts, the selection process for CEN-02/2024 is expected to be multi-staged to ensure a thorough assessment of candidates. The primary stage is likely to be a Computer Based Test (CBT) assessing knowledge in subjects like Mathematics, General Intelligence & Reasoning, General Science, and General Awareness. Candidates who qualify the CBT may be called for subsequent stages, which could include a Physical Efficiency Test (PET) or a Document Verification (DV) round. A final and mandatory Medical Examination is conducted to ensure candidates meet the prescribed physical and medical standards required for technical roles in the Railways. The exact pattern, syllabus, and weightage for each stage will be detailed in the official notification.
How to Apply
Applications for this RRB recruitment will be accepted exclusively online through the official RRB regional websites. The step-by-step process typically involves: First, visiting the official portal and completing a one-time registration to obtain a Registration ID. Second, logging in to fill the detailed application form with personal, educational, and communication details. Third, uploading scanned documents—photograph, signature, and relevant certificates—as per the specified format and size (usually JPEG, with photograph size 20KB-50KB and signature size 10KB-20KB). Fourth, paying the application fee through online modes like net banking, credit/debit card, or offline via SBI challan. Finally, submitting the form and downloading/printing the confirmation page for future reference. Keep all educational certificates, caste/disability certificates (if applicable), photo ID proof, and fee payment receipt ready during the process.

Preparation Tips
To crack the RRB Technician exam, a disciplined and strategic approach is essential. Begin by thoroughly understanding the exam syllabus and pattern once released. Focus on strengthening core subjects: for Mathematics, practice topics like Percentage, Profit & Loss, Time & Work, and Geometry from standard books like R.S. Aggarwal's 'Quantitative Aptitude'. For General Intelligence & Reasoning, practice analogies, coding-decoding, and puzzles. General Science requires a good grasp of NCERT Physics, Chemistry, and Biology up to the 10th standard. For General Awareness, regularly read newspapers and follow current affairs, with special attention to developments in Indian Railways and science & technology. Solve previous years' question papers and take regular mock tests to improve speed and accuracy. Dedicate daily study hours and revise formulas and important facts consistently.
